/**
 * @fileoverview:   Newsday Online Access Stylesheet
 * @author:         Matthew Cassella, Matthew Hogeboom
 * @company:        Newsday Media Group
 * @version:        Last Changed in: GR1
**/

#bodyContainer {background:#FFFFFF;}
#digSub .container {border-top: 1px solid #333333;padding-top:22px;display:block;overflow:hidden;padding:12px;margin:22px 0;font-size:16px;clear:both;}
.online #digSub .container.home, .subscribe #digSub .container.dig {border-top: 1px solid #333333;padding-top:22px}
#digSub .container > div, #digSub .container > img {float:left;border:none;margin:12px 0 0;}
#digSub .container > img {float:left;}
#digSub p.title {display:block;padding:14px 0 0 14px;font-size:16px}
#digSub .container p.sub {display:block;font-size:12px;float:left;clear:both;width:640px;line-height:1.3em;}
#digSub .container p.disclaimer {clear:both;font-size:15px;color:#000;width:660px;line-height:1.3em;float:left}
#digSub .dig > img {margin:12px;margin:0;}
#digSub .container > div {width:252px;padding:0;margin:12px 12px 0 0;}
#digSub .container h1 {font-size:32px;padding:0 0 8px;margin:0;font-weight:bold;}
#digSub .container h2 {font-size:22px;padding:0 0 8px;margin:0;font-weight:bold;} 
#digSub .container h2 span {font-size:20px;position:relative;top:-2px;}
#digSub .container p {padding:0 0 8px;font-size:16px;}
#digSub .container ul {list-style:disc inside;font-size:13px;padding:0;margin:30px 0 12px 14px;float:left;line-height:1em;font-weight:normal;color:#767676;}
#digSub .container ul li {padding:4px 0;}
#digSub .container .trail {background:url("http://www.newsday.com/css/newsday/rd2/img/trailoff.jpg") no-repeat -2232px 0;overflow:hidden;padding:24px;font-size:14px;margin:12px -10px;width:915px;height:50px;position:relative;}
#digSub .container .trail p, #digSub .container .trail fieldset {float:left;}
#digSub .container .trail p {width:380px;font-size:14px;color:#4A4A4A;line-height:1.25em;}
#digSub .container .trail fieldset {width:240px;margin:0 0 0 5px;padding:0;position:relative;}
#digSub .container .trail fieldset input[type="text"] {border:1px solid #CCCCCC;padding:4px 6px;width:220px;height:18px;-moz-border-radius:4px;-webkit-border-radius:4px;vertical-align:top;color:#333333;}
#digSub .container .trail fieldset input.zip {width:120px;}
#digSub .container .trail span {position:absolute;left:410px;top:60px;font-size:11px;color:#666666;}
#printSubForm {clear:both;}
#digitalSubForm .btn {margin-left:40px;padding:12px 62px}
#digitalSubForm .btn:hover {background-position: 0pt -784px;}
label { width: 10em; float: left; }
label.error {top:0;right:0;color:#FFFFFF;padding:4px 8px;margin:0;background:none #FF0000;border:none;-moz-border-radius:4px;-webkit-border-radius:4px;font-size:12px;width:120px;position:absolute;top:32px;left:0}
#masthead #logo {background: url("http://www.newsday.com/polopoly_fs/1.3092488.1313157907!/image/image.png") no-repeat scroll 10px 0 transparent;display: block; float: left; height: 90px; overflow: hidden;text-indent: -9999px;width: 309px;}
#digSub .container .trail fieldset.zip {width:270px;}
fieldset.zip input {float:left;margin-right:4px}
.subscribe #breadcrumbs h2 {float:left;margin-right:12px;}

/* Digital subscription sponsorship ------------------- */
#sponsor {float:left; width:250px}
#sponsor img {margin-left:19px; border: none}